• Variation problems involve fairly simple relationships or
formulas, involving one variable being equal to one term.
Here follows the most common kinds of variation.
• The constant of variation in a direct variation is the
constant (unchanged) ratio of two variable quantities. In the
following equation y varies directly with x, and k is called
the constant of variation:
y=kx
• Another form of variation is the inverse variation which
works when there is a relationship between two variables in
which the product is a constant. When one variable
increases the other decreases in proportion so that the
product is unchanged.
• If y is inversely proportional to x and k is a constant, the
equation is of the form:
k
y= x
Types of Variation
• Direct Variation: y varies directly as x. As x increases, y
also increases. As x decreases, y also decreases.
y=kx
• Inverse Variation: y varies inversely as x. As x increases, y
decreases. As x decreases, y increases. The product of x
and y is always constant.
k
y= x
